- Welcome to Phrack Pro-Phile. Phrack Pro-Phile is created to bring info to
- you, the users, about old or highly important/controversial people. This
- month, I bring to you the one of the earlier hackers to make headlines and
- legal journals due to computer hacking...
-
- (_>Shadow Hawk 1<_)

- I started working with computers in the 6th grade with an Atari 800 and
- a cassette drive. I added a modem and a disk drive and started researching
- other computer systems [checking out other hacker's conquests ;-) ].
- Eventually, I decided that UNIX was to be the OS of choice.
-
- As a child, I was always curious about stuff in my own reality, so
- naturally, when computers became available...
-
- I first owned an Atari 800, then an Atari ST 1040, followed by a short-
- lived Unix-PC 3B1, and a lame 20MHz 386. Currently, I have a 33MHz 386. Most
- of my hacking-type knowledge came from a text file that listed a few Unix
- defaults; I used those to go and learn more on my own. Other OSes, I just
- hacked at random 8-).
-
- I started out with systems that had already been penetrated and I built up
- my own database of systems from there. I wasn't too clever in the beginning,
- though, and lost a few systems to perceptive sys-admins.
-
- I specialized in Unix, though I enjoyed toying with obscure systems
- (RSX-11, Sorbus Realtime Basic, etc.)
-
- In the hack/phreak world, I used to hang out with The Prophet, The Serpent
- (Chicago), The Warrior, and others for short periods of time, who shall remain
- nameless.
-
- As far as what were memorable hack/phreak BBSes, I'd have to say none...
- Not that there weren't any, but I have just forgotten them all.
-
- My accomplishments in the phreak/hack world include writing a few text
- files, typing in a few books, getting in lots of systems, and learning a bit
- about the Unix OS. Other than that, absolutely nothing; my life is computers!
- (NOT!)
-
- I _was_ associated with the J-Men a few years back, but that's the only
- hack/phreak group that I ever had anything to do with.
-
- I was busted for overzealousness in penetrating AT&T computer networks and
- systems. I stupidly made calls from my unprotected home phone. I got caught
- trying to snag Unix SysV 3.5 68K kernel source.
-
- I had already given up the practice of sharing information when I realized
- how quickly systems went away after their numbers and logins were posted 8-).
- After I got busted, I decided it might be best to limit my hacking to those
- strata of reality on which it is not (yet) prohibited to hack ;-) .

- Most Memorable Experience
- DD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DD
- Coming home to a house full of Secret Service, FBI, NSA, DIA, and AT&T agents
- after getting really stoned with some neighborhood friends, and then having
- them take everything electronic that didn't appear to be a household appliance
- EXCEPT the obviously stolen/dangerous items: a digital power meter, a He-Ne
- laser, and jars of chemicals for making bombs. HUMOR AT ITS FINEST!
-
- Some People to Mention
- DD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DDD
- o Thanks to Bill Cook for leaving no stone unturned in my personal life!
- o Thanks to "my" lawyer, Karen Plant, for leaving MANY stones unturned in
- helping to decide my fate!
- o Thanks to the U.S. Federal Justice System for sentencing me to a 9 months
- in a "juvenile facility" (as well as confiscating thousands of dollars of
- stuff, some legal & some not) while allowing burglars, politicians, and
- virus-authors to go free with a slap on the wrist!
- o Thanks for Operation Sun-Devil, without which, the venerable Ripco BBS
- would still be in its first incarnation!
